Gopala
Gopala is a village located in Tarikere taluka of Chikmagalur district in Karnataka, India. It is situated 24km away from sub-district headquarter Tarikere (tehsildar office) and 78km away from district headquarter Chikmagalur. As per 2009 stats, Gopala village is also a gram panchayat.

About Gopala
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Gopala is 609104. The village spans a total geographical area of 851.08 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 577144. Tarikere is nearest town to Gopala village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 24km away.
When it comes to local governance, Gopala village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Tarikere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Udupi Chikkamagaluru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Gopala
Below is a concise population overview of Gopala as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 2,241 | 1,133 | 1,108 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 251 | 130 | 121 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 717 | 342 | 375 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 47 | 27 | 20 |
Literate Population | 1,366 | 768 | 598 |
Illiterate Population | 875 | 365 | 510 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Gopala village:
- The total population of Gopala village is around 2,241, including approximately 1,133 males and 1,108 females, with a sex ratio of 977 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 251 children aged 0–6 years in Gopala village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Gopala village has 717 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 47 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Gopala village is about 60.95%, with male literacy at 67.78% and female literacy at 53.97%.
- There are around 534 households in Gopala village.
Connectivity of Gopala
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Gopala. As per the 2011 stats, Gopala had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
